Geekbench 5 Benchmarks
Intel Core i7-8700K | vs | Intel Core i5-12600K |
---|---|---|
Oct 5th, 2017 | Release Date | Nov 4th, 2021 |
Core i7 | Collection | Core i5 |
Coffee Lake | Codename | Alder Lake |
Intel Socket 1151 | Socket | Intel Socket 1700 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
6 | Cores | 10 |
12 | Threads | 16 |
3.7 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 3.7 GHz |
4.7 GHz | Turbo Clock Speed | 4.9 GHz |
95 W | TDP | 125 W |
14 nm | Process Size | 10 nm |
37.0x | Multiplier | 37.0x |
UHD Graphics 630 | Integrated Graphics | UHD Graphics 770 |
Yes | Overclockable | Yes |
